SUMMARY THE LOVE HYPOTHESIS BASED ON THE BOOK BY ALI HAZELWOOD SUMMARY WRITTEN BY: FASTBOOKS PUBLISHING CONTENT Introduction to Olive and Her World The Fake Dating Arrangement The Strain of Academia and Romance Growing Feelings and Confusion Tension Rises Secrets and Lies The Breakthrough Confessions and Challenges Resolution and Growth General Analysis of The Love Hypothesis ABOUT THE ORIGINAL BOOK “The Love Hypothesis” by Ali Hazelwood follows Olive Smith, a Ph.D. student in biology at Stanford, who fakes a relationship with gruff professor Adam Carlsen to convince her best friend that she’s over her ex. As their fake relationship deepens, Olive finds herself struggling with real emotions for Adam, while navigating the pressures of academia, her career, and the challenges women face in STEM fields. The book explores themes of love, vulnerability, personal growth, and balancing professional ambitions with romance, all wrapped in humor and heartfelt moments. It’s a journey of self-discovery and navigating complex relationships.
